Zusammenfassung:The European Polarstern Study (EPOS) brought together scientists from Western and Central Europe and South America who participated in a series of three cruises on the ice-breaking research vessel "Polarstern" to the Weddell Sea, Antarctica, 1988/1989. EPOS was directed to investigate ice biota and the role of sea ice in the pelagic system, the benthos and fish. The articles in this volume represent some of the contributions presented at the EPOS Symposium held in Bremerhaven, Germany, in May 1991.
